[PATCH 06/15] driver model: anti-oopsing medicine

From: Greg Kroah-Hartman
Date: Thu Aug 21 2008 - 13:38:11 EST


From: David Brownell <dbrownell@xx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xx>

Anti-oops medicine for the class iterators ... the oops was
observed when a class was implicitly referenced before it
was initialized.

[Modified by Greg to spit a warning back so someone knows to fix their code]

diff --git a/drivers/base/class.c b/drivers/base/class.c
index 5667c2f..cc5e28c 100644
--- a/drivers/base/class.c
+++ b/drivers/base/class.c
@@ -295,6 +295,12 @@ int class_for_each_device(struct class *class, struct device *start,

if (!class)
return -EINVAL;
+ if (!class->p) {
+ WARN(1, "%s called for class '%s' before it was initialized",
+ __func__, class->name);
+ return -EINVAL;
+ }
+
mutex_lock(&class->p->class_mutex);
list_for_each_entry(dev, &class->p->class_devices, node) {
if (start) {
@@ -344,6 +350,11 @@ struct device *class_find_device(struct class *class, struct device *start,

if (!class)
return NULL;
+ if (!class->p) {
+ WARN(1, "%s called for class '%s' before it was initialized",
+ __func__, class->name);
+ return NULL;
+ }

mutex_lock(&class->p->class_mutex);
list_for_each_entry(dev, &class->p->class_devices, node) {
